HerdKixButt Wrote:Ok after reading this thread I'm still scratching my head at why Indiana would not want to stay in the Big 10.......
Obviously, Indiana would NEVER leave the Big Televen. The only thing that might happen down the road would be for the Big East to try to get a few more football schools or something. There's also the possibility that the SEC will kick out Vanderbilt, the Big 12 will kick out Baylor, the SEC will invite FSU and the Big 12 will invite Arkansas. Then, the ACC would be looking for another school, which I would imagine would be Syracuse or Penn State. Then, of course, the Big East would look for a replacement for 'Cuse, and the Big Televen would probably make another run at ND or would consider Pitt.

The only way the MAC or C-USA is affected is if the Big East takes someone -- most likely a C-USA school like UCF or USF. I still woudn't be convinced that anything would happen to the MAC, however.

The biggest thing that could happen to the MAC is if the proposed attendance rules actually went into effect (which I don't believe they will -- it's too arbitrary), and the MAC lost a few schools. Then, I know several schools would not see the MAC as a viable conference.

And, KT, lighten up, man. The 03-wink means I was joking.

One reason I don't see the SEC kicking out Vandy, though, is that Vandy gives the SEC some academic credibility, and it would be incredibly hard to justify from a PR stanpoint -- especially since their basketball is very solid.

This conversation is crazy. Successful conferences have the following personality:

-Schools with common academic and athletic profiles.
-A GEOGRAPHIC IDENTITY.
-All sports participation.

Look at history. What has happen to conferences and schools that did not meet the above. They are either gone, in trouble, or WILL be.
